( 1 | 2 | 3 | 4 ) »Sorenson Media announced today the Public Beta of Sorenson Squeeze 4.2 for Windows. Both the Compression Suite and Squeeze for Flash feature expanded abilities to generate Flash 8 files including support for the On2 VP6 professional codec with two-pass VBR as well as a new FLV player and expanded Flash Video Player templates.
Beta versions of Sorenson Squeeze 4.2 Compression Suite and Sorenson Squeeze 4.2 for Macromedia Flash are available now for free and can be downloaded at http://www.sorensonmedia.com/misc/beta.php.
The professional version of the On2 VP6 plug-in for Sorenson Squeeze 4.2 Compression Suite and Sorenson Squeeze 4.2 for Flash will be available for US $199.00. Sorenson Squeeze 4.2 is a free upgrade to owners of Squeeze 4.0 or later. Sorenson Squeeze 4.2 for Windows will be available in Q3 2005; a Mac version will release in Q4 2005.

For 2006, the West Coast FlashForward conference is being moved to the Washington State Convention and Trade Center in Seattle, WA. Dates are set for February 27-March 2.
Nominations for the 2006 Seattle Flash Film Festival are now being accepted through Friday, December 2, 2005. Categories are Application, Art, Cartoon, Commerce, Educational, Experimental, Game, Motion Graphics, Navigation, Original Sound, Story, Technical Merit, 3D, Typography, and Video.

Submissions are now being accepted to the SXSW (South by Southwest) 2006 Web Awards. Enter by Friday, October 14, 2005 and the application fee is only $10. After that, it goes up to $25 (deadline of December 16, 2005). By entering the website competition, you are also given the option to register for SXSW Interactive 2006 at the lowest rate until February.
Categories for the 2006 Web Awards include Amusement, Art, Blog, Business: For-Profit, Business: Green/Non-Profit, CSS, Classic, Community/Wiki, Educational Resource, Experimental, Film/TV, Flash, Music, Personal Portfolio, Student, and Technical Achievement, as well as People's Choice and Best of Show.
